On 8/30/22 09:34, Michal Hocko wrote:
> [Cc Dan]
> Dan has brought up[1] that the use of gfp mask has confused his static
> analyzer which assumes that GFP_HIGHUSER_MOVABLE implies a sleeping
> allocation and that wouldn't be a great idea from the panic path. I
> would add that most callers of this function would be really bad to
> allocate.
>
> The report itself is a false positive but it made me think a bit about
> this. Even if the check is too simplistic I guess it resembles how many
> developers are thinking (including me). If I see GFP_HIGHUSER_MOVABLE or
> GF_KERNEL I automatically assume a sleeping allocation down the road.
> And who know somebody might add one in the future even into show_mem
> because the gfp parameter would be too tempting to not (ab)use.
>
> My original intention was to use a natural allocation speak but this can
> backfire so maybe it would be better to give the argument its real
> meaning and that is the high_zone_idx. This is cryptic for code outside
> of MM but that is not all that many callers and we can hide this fact
> from them. In other words does the thing below looks better (incremental
> for illustration, I will make it a proper patch if yes)?

Yeah, looks better to me this way. Thanks!
